About Colombian black bean tamale

Colombian Black Bean Tamale is a traditional dish from Colombian cuisine, celebrated for its rich flavors and wholesome ingredients. This tamale is crafted from a mixture of corn masa and black beans, seasoned with garlic, onions, and an array of spices, then wrapped in banana leaves and steamed to perfection. The black beans provide a hearty source of plant-based protein, dietary fiber, and essential minerals like iron and magnesium, making it a nutritious choice. The corn masa offers energy-supporting carbohydrates, while the banana leaves impart a subtle, earthy flavor without adding calories. While this dish is relatively low in fat, its sodium content can vary depending on seasoning. Typically vegetarian and sometimes vegan, the Colombian Black Bean Tamale is a nourishing staple that bridges flavor and health, making it a favorite across generations.
